Output 65b86ed40a4c50a592d6ce5015065f8cce451ae1bea7d345a966d0496cc1c6e1:20

value
9427444123
script pubkey
OP_0 OP_PUSHBYTES_20 08da93bfad48bddcdaf49e65248c3195a1838caa
address
bc1qprdf80adfz7aekh5nejjfrp3jksc8r929svpxk
transaction
65b86ed40a4c50a592d6ce5015065f8cce451ae1bea7d345a966d0496cc1c6e1
spent
true